Police Say Firing at Cricketer Naseem Shah’s House Likely Linked to Land Dispute

Police have registered a case after unknown assailants opened fire at the house of Pakistani fast bowler Naseem Shah in Lower Dir. According to officials, the incident does not appear to be terrorism-related, but rather the result of a land dispute or local rivalry.
Police stated that evidence has been collected, and the investigation is underway from all angles. The District Police Officer (DPO) met Naseem Shah’s father and assured prompt action to arrest the culprits.
The fast bowler was not at home when the incident took place, and fortunately, no injuries were reported.
In his statement, Naseem Shah’s father said that their family has no enmity or ongoing disputes with anyone. The suspects fled the scene immediately after the firing.

In Lower Dir, there was a shocking incident of firing at Naseem Shah’s room, the fast bowler of Pakistan’s national cricket team. According to police, the main gate, windows, and a vehicle at the residence were partially damaged. Following the incident, a case has been registered, and investigations are underway.
Police reported that security in the area was immediately increased after the firing. Officers remain on the scene to prevent further damage and ensure safety.

Five suspects have been taken into custody for questioning regarding the incident. Police are collecting more evidence and trying to identify the exact circumstances of the attack.
Authorities have urged the public to report any suspicious activity immediately to help prevent similar incidents in the future. The police are committed to taking strict action against the responsible individuals.
